big ugly dish
A C-band satellite dish used by television receive-only (TVRO) systems, ranging from 4 to 16 feet in diameter.
big ugly dish: the workhorse C-band satellite receiver
A big ugly dish is a fixed parabolic antenna, typically 4 to 16 feet in diameter, designed to receive C-band satellite television signals at frequencies around 3.7 to 4.2 GHz. These dishes became the standard equipment for television receive-only (TVRO) systems from the 1970s onward, allowing cable operators and direct-to-home viewers to pull in distant broadcast feeds without relying on terrestrial infrastructure.
The name, though derogatory, stuck because these dishes are visibly large, mechanically prominent structures. Unlike the smaller Ku-band dishes that followed in the 1980s and 1990s, C-band dishes require substantial size to gather enough signal energy at their lower frequency; the longer wavelength demands a correspondingly larger collecting surface. A 10-foot dish is common for reliable reception; smaller dishes suffer signal loss in rain, larger ones are overkill for most applications and consume floor or roof space.
Mechanical and electrical reality
The dish itself is usually made of spun aluminum or mesh metal stretched over a steel frame. It feeds into a C-band feedhorn and low-noise block downconverter (LNB) mounted at the focal point. The LNB amplifies the weak incoming signal and shifts it down to L-band, typically 950 to 1450 MHz, for transmission via coax cable to the receiver indoors. Most installations require a motorized mount to track multiple satellites across the arc, though some operators fix the dish on a single orbital position.
These systems dominated commercial and cable-head-end reception through the 1990s because C-band satellites carry strong, unencrypted feeds that could be reliably received even with modest equipment. They remain in use at broadcast facilities, disaster response sites, and remote locations where internet backhaul is unavailable. Rain fade is a real problem: heavy downpour can reduce signal by 3 to 6 dB or more, depending on frequency and rain rate.
The term 'big ugly dish' is now historical. Ku-band and direct-to-home systems made them less fashionable for residential use, and satellite internet now uses different architectures entirely. In the trade, however, the phrase persists as shorthand for large fixed C-band receive antennas, especially among broadcast engineers and satellite operators who still maintain them.
